Rodolfo Giometti wrote:

> I'm just working on adding USB device support for au1100 CPUs.

> I wrote the driver (attached) but I cannot understand why when I
> insert the USB cable I see no activities on the bus... my USB sniffer
> says that the target port is "disconnected/reset".

> USB host controller is working so I suppose the clock is well routed
> to USB device controller too.

    What tree are you testing against? Asking because with the recent deletion 
of the "old" driver (arch/mips/au1000/common/usbdev.c), the setup code 
fiddling with SYS_PINFUNC and SYS_CLKSRC regs is gone...

> Someone may halp me in understing where the problem could be? My
> driver doesn't use DMA, as suggested by the CPU's data sheet... it
> could be wrong?

    Well, errata says you must use DMA for endpoint 0 on Au1100 revs before BE 
-- otherwise you'll be asking for trouble.
